Global Software Outsourcing Market size was valued at USD 544.22 Billion in 2024 and is poised to grow from USD 574.7 Billion in 2025 to USD 888.69 Billion by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 5.6% during the forecast period (2026-2033).
Demand for digital transformation has become the primary driver of the software outsourcing market, as organizations seek rapid access to specialized talent and scalable delivery models that internal teams cannot provide. The market, encompassing offshore and nearshore contracting for application development, maintenance, testing and cloud services, matters because it accelerates innovation while optimizing costs and time to market. Over decades the sector evolved from simple cost arbitrage in the 1990s to complex strategic partnerships in the 2020s, exemplified by banks engaging Indian firms for core modernization and startups leveraging Eastern European teams for AI prototyping, which demonstrates maturation and diversification.Advances in cloud platforms and artificial intelligence serve as the key factor driving software outsourcing growth because they create demand for external expertise that internal IT departments rarely possess at scale. As companies adopt multicloud architectures and machine learning, they outsource migration, model training and DevOps to specialized vendors, accelerating rollout and reducing capital expenditure. For example, a retail chain might contract nearshore teams to deploy recommendation engines on cloud services, improving conversion rates and allowing the retailer to focus on core operations. Consequently vendors shift from commodity coding to productized services and outcome based contracts, opening new revenue streams.
How is AI reshaping the software outsourcing market?
AI is reshaping the software outsourcing market through automation of engineering tasks, augmentation of developer workflows, and evolving delivery models. Vendors increasingly offer AI assisted coding, automated testing, and intelligent monitoring which speed delivery and reduce manual rework. Buyers expect outcome based relationships and value from integrated AI tools rather than labor arbitrage. The shift moves work toward higher value activities such as system integration, governance, and design of AI enabled processes. Examples include code generation for modules, AI driven quality assurance, and agentic automation applied to operations. The market focuses on partnership and capability building over cost savings.Infosys February 2026, unveiled an AI first value framework and its Topaz agentic suite which embed generative and agentic AI into service delivery. That development helps outsourcing providers scale AI augmented engineering, accelerate modernization of legacy systems, and improve delivery efficiency by automating repetitive tasks and standardizing governance across client engagements.

Application Development Outsourcing segment dominates because it concentrates the core capability to design and deliver bespoke software that drives client digital initiatives. Demand for tailored applications, integration with legacy systems, and rapid feature delivery pushes clients to outsource to firms with broad technical stacks and product management expertise. This positioning creates deep client relationships and recurring project pipelines as providers assume responsibility for end-to-end delivery, accelerating adoption of outsourced application programs.
However, Testing & Quality Assurance (QA) Services is the most rapidly expanding area as demand for automated and continuous testing surges. Integration with DevOps pipelines, security-focused validation, and the need for reliable releases encourage outsourcing of specialized QA talent and platformized testing tools, unlocking faster product cycles and new managed service opportunities.
Cloud & DevOps Support segment dominates because it provides the operational backbone that enables scalable, resilient outsourced systems and continuous delivery practices. Organizations prioritize providers who can manage cloud platforms, automation, and infrastructure as code to reduce deployment friction and maintain uptime. This drives sustained outsourcing demand for integrated cloud engineering, observability, and platform operations expertise that directly improves time to market and lowers operational risk for complex software estates.
Meanwhile, AI & Machine Learning Development is the most rapidly expanding area as demand for predictive automation grows. Broader adoption of models in customer experience and operations, plus needs for data science and model operations expertise, drives outsourcing of ML pipelines and creates new managed services and productized AI offerings.

North America dominates the global software outsourcing market due to a combination of deep enterprise demand, mature technology ecosystems, and a concentration of leading service providers. Large enterprises and innovative startups both seek external expertise to accelerate product development and modernization initiatives, creating sustained demand for outsourced capabilities. Well developed legal and regulatory frameworks, strong intellectual property protection, and accessible capital markets encourage investment and partnerships. Close collaboration between buyers and providers, combined with high expectations for quality and security, reinforces North America position as a primary demand center and innovation hub for outsourced software services. A balance between competitive pricing and outcome oriented engagements fosters long term partnerships, while cultural proximity and robust delivery practices reduce complexity in cross border programs, reinforcing North America status as a preferred sourcing destination.
Software Outsourcing Market United States benefits from a dense concentration of enterprise buyers, technology innovators, and specialized service providers that drive demand for advanced engineering, cloud migration, and product development services. Emphasis on security, compliance, and scalability shapes provider offerings. Close collaboration between in house teams and external partners, supported by mature procurement practices and sophisticated vendor ecosystems, enables complex engagements and strategic long term relationships across vertical industries nationwide.
Software Outsourcing Market Canada is characterized by a collaborative environment between public and private sectors, a growing community of technology firms, and close commercial ties to larger North America markets. Providers emphasize bilingual delivery, data privacy compliance, and sector specific expertise that appeals to regional buyers. Focus on innovation partnerships and talent retention supports scalable outsourcing models, while government incentives and stable regulatory conditions enhance confidence for cross border engagements.
Europe rapid expansion in software outsourcing is propelled by a mix of increasing enterprise modernization needs, availability of highly skilled engineering talent, and the appeal of nearshore partnerships for neighboring markets. Mature vendor ecosystems across Western Europe emphasize specialized domain knowledge, multilingual delivery, and adherence to rigorous data protection and regulatory standards, which reassures international clients. Cost quality dynamics favor competitive but value focused engagements, while strong research institutions and industry clusters in sectors such as manufacturing, automotive, and financial services generate demand for advanced software capabilities. Governments and regional initiatives that support digital skills development and innovation hubs further stimulate provider capabilities and help transform local firms into strategic outsourcing partners for global buyers. Tighter collaboration models and certification driven quality practices enable smoother delivery and make Europe an attractive alternative for clients seeking dependable partners.
Software Outsourcing Market Germany is anchored by deep industrial expertise and demand from manufacturing, automotive, and industrial automation sectors that require high quality engineering and systems integration. Providers often combine domain knowledge with rigorous engineering practices and compliance orientation, appealing to global clients seeking robust, reliable solutions. Emphasis on process maturity, education, and collaborative research fosters long term strategic partnerships and positions Germany as a dominant contracting hub within Europe.
Software Outsourcing Market United Kingdom is driven by a cluster of financial services and technology industries that demand agile software delivery and innovation. Providers emphasize consulting led engagements, cloud native architectures, and strong client governance to meet complex enterprise needs. Language and cultural alignment with global buyers, combined with a mature vendor market and emphasis on talent and professional services, sustain the United Kingdom role as a European outsourcing center.
Software Outsourcing Market France is experiencing dynamic growth driven by a vibrant startup ecosystem and expanding digital transformation across enterprises. Providers emphasize design led development, specialist consulting, and growing expertise in cloud and data platforms. Bilingual delivery, increased talent supply from technical education, and stronger collaboration between public research and private firms accelerate market maturation and support France emergence as a rapidly expanding outsourcing destination within Europe for global clients.
Asia Pacific is strengthening its role in software outsourcing by expanding technical depth, cultivating specialized industry expertise, and improving global delivery capabilities. Markets across the region combine mature engineering education with strong hardware and software ecosystems, enabling providers to offer integrated solutions for sectors such as electronics, gaming, mobile, and advanced manufacturing. Investments in cloud native practices, automation, and quality assurance elevate delivery standards. Closer ties with global buyers and strategic partnerships support knowledge transfer, while government initiatives and private investment enhance talent pipelines and innovation capacity. Together these dynamics make Asia Pacific an increasingly attractive complement to traditional outsourcing centers, offering high quality engineering, domain specialization, and diversified sourcing options for international clients. A growing focus on research and development, certification driven quality practices, and improved English language capabilities among technical staff further increase confidence among multinational buyers and enable complex end to end engagements across time zones.
Software Outsourcing Market Japan centers on precision engineering, systems integration, and solutions tailored to complex hardware oriented industries. Providers leverage strong research capabilities and deep domain knowledge in robotics, automotive systems, and industrial controls to meet exacting client standards. Cultural emphasis on craftsmanship and long term supplier relationships supports high quality delivery, while gradual increases in global collaboration and English language proficiency expand Japan ability to serve multinational outsourcing programs.
Software Outsourcing Market South Korea is characterized by a strong technology and innovation ecosystem, with providers experienced in mobile, gaming, semiconductor software, and AI driven applications. A culture of rapid iteration and high technical standards enables fast, high quality development cycles for demanding clients. Growing global ambitions, combined with supportive public policies and close collaboration between large corporates and agile vendors, position South Korea as an important regional outsourcing partner.

Competition in global software outsourcing is sharpening as large systems integrators and regional managed service firms compete on AI enabled delivery, cloud compliance and nearshore speed. This has driven concrete M&A and alliance moves, such as Capgemini acquiring Syniti to bolster data and SAP transformation capabilities and Accenture expanding its Google Cloud alliance to scale generative AI services. Vendors use acquisitions, partnerships and proprietary platforms to differentiate.
